Technical analysis attempts to predict future price movements in financial markets by studying past market data. Traders utilize various tools and indicators, such as chart patterns, moving averages, and oscillators, to identify potential trends and indicating buy or sell opportunities. By analyzing these market signals, technicians attempt to acquire an edge in the volatile world of finance.

  • Fundamental analysis focuses on a company's intrinsic value by evaluating financial statements and economic indicators.
  • Technical analysis, on the other hand, depends solely on past market data to predict future price movements.

Some popular technical indicators include: Moving averages, Relative Strength Index (RSI), MACD. These tools help traders evaluate the strength and direction of a trend.

Ultimately, technical analysis can be a valuable tool for traders who seek to understand market dynamics and make informed trading decisions.

Unlocking Hidden Insights: Volume Analysis for Traders

Volume analysis provides traders with a crucial tool to confirm price movements and recognize potential trends. By studying the magnitude of trading activity, traders can gain valuable insights into market sentiment.

High volume often corroborates strong belief behind a price move, while low volume may imply weakness.

Traders can utilize volume analysis in combination with other technical indicators to confirm trading decisions. Consider, a breakout above resistance accompanied by significant volume is often considered a positive signal, indicating that the price momentum may persist. Conversely, a breakdown below support with low volume may reveal a temporary reversal and an opportunity to enter the market.

Harness the Power of Price Action: Unveiling Profitable Trading Techniques

In the dynamic realm of trading, mastering price action can unlock significant opportunities for profit. Price action refers to the analysis of past and present price movements signals to predict future price trends. Experienced traders leverage this knowledge to identify entry and exit points, maximizing their chances of success.

One effective strategy is identifying key support and resistance levels. Support levels represent price floors where buying pressure is strong, while resistance levels indicate price ceilings where selling pressure prevails. By interpreting these levels, traders can predict potential reversals or movements.

  • Another popular strategy involves analyzing chart patterns. Familiarize yourself with frequent patterns such as head and shoulders, double tops, and triangles, as they often signal future price movements.
  • Technical indicators can also provide valuable insights into price action. Indicators like moving averages, relative strength index (RSI), and MACD help to validate trading signals and identify potential buy or sell opportunities.

Remember that successful price action trading requires discipline, rigorous analysis, and constant learning. By continuously refining your skills and adapting to market conditions, you can increase your chances of obtaining consistent profitability.
